Globalization is a process, which competitiveness and positioning on the market setting as a demanding process for survival and economic progress. The sector of civil engineering has special importance in every national economy, in particular, due to the wide and significant multiplier effect on all other economic and non business activities and export oriented business. Our goal was to define aspects through the concept of this work, which should contribute to a more efficient adaption to global challenges and the principles and practices of European and global companies and the more intensive use of globalization. We conducted research on the operations of 57 construction companies from Bosnia and Herzegovina, which operate on the domestic and foreign markets, with accent on human resources, as the most important factor of competitiveness. We also interviewed eight German s construction companies wich have been cooperating with companies from Bosnia and Herzegovina and determined the perception of German investors about the competitive advantages and weakness which companies own in our country. The results of this research give a scientific contribution to the development of business organization, management and competitiveness of the companies and applicative contribution to the more efficient operation of bh. construction companyes on the EU and world markets.
